Job summary

Sperry Rail, Inc. is seeking a Lead Data Scientist, Rail Data and Risk, to define and deliver analyses that identify where risk sits in track and how it evolves across North America.

You will lead a small team, hire two new seats in the near term, and drive models from exploration to production in collaboration with the commercial team. Responsibilities

  • Trend Sperry's multi-modal test data over time – internal flaw detection, induction, and eddy current – for defect growth and surface condition degradation across our non-stop inspection programs in North America
  • Connect raw test measurements and their metadata to the physical conditions they represent: internal defects, surface conditions, rail flaws
  • Analyze defect and error types and frequency by subdivision to identify where risk is concentrated and how it moves
  • Apply risk-based models to estimate the probability and consequence of failure
  • Own the KPIs for the monthly operational review and customer account review meetings
  • Present findings to the commercial team in a form they can use in account conversations
  • Work with the analysis organization so that what the data shows about defect and surface-condition patterns reaches the analysts reviewing that track
  • Present risk findings to customers alongside the commercial team
  • Identify gaps in current data collection and recommend what Sperry should capture to support better analysis
  • Validate findings against field conditions with track engineering and testing teams
  • Hire and line manage the two further seats in the pod, and direct their work
  • Write and maintain documentation so that the analysis is transferable rather than held tacitly
